How To Fix REBDCA018 - Higher-level objects of &1 are already assigned in another hierarchy


REBDCA018 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: REBDCA - Messages for Master Data - General

  • Message number: 018

  • Message text: Higher-level objects of &1 are already assigned in another hierarchy

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    A usage object, which is superordinate to the current usage object, is
    already assigned to a different architectural hierarchy. The subordinate
    object, however, has to be assigned to the same architectural hierarchy
    as its superordinate object.

    System Response

    It is not possible to assign the current usage object to the selected
    architectural hierarchy.

    How to fix this error?

    Select an architectural object from the same hierarchy to which the
    superordinate usage object is assigned.
